How much do manager subway j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ager subway in Cheney, WA is $62,537.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$44,100.00 and $72,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a manager Subway?

A Subway manager is responsible for overseeing the daily operations of a Subway restaurant. Their duties include managing staff, ensuring food safety and quality, handling inventory and ordering supplies, maintaining customer service standards, and achieving sales goals. They also handle scheduling, training new employees, and addressing any issues that may arise in the restaurant. Strong leadership and organizational skills are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a manager at Subway?

To thrive as a Manager at Subway, you need expertise in food service operations, staff supervision, inventory management,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, scheduling software, and food safety certifications like ServSafe is typically required. Exceptional leadership, problem-solving, and customer service skills help you motivate teams and handle challenging situations. These abilities are crucial for ensuring efficient operations, customer satisfaction, and compliance with food safety and company standards.

Job description

As part of the Subway Team, you as a Shift Leader will focus on six main things:
  • Providing an excellent guest experience
  • Ensuring that great food is prepared & served
  • Keeping our restaurants functional, clean and beautiful
  • Controlling inventory
  • Scheduling and supervising staff
  • Being a team player

In addition to the role of a typical Sandwich Artist, key parts of your day to day will consist of:
  • Cascading training to Sandwich Artists on existing and new responsibilities
  • Scheduling and supervising staff
  • Practicing inventory control standards
  • Ensuring equipment is in proper working order during shift
  • Completing paperwork as needed

As a Subway Team Member, you'll have access to:
  • Brand partnership discounts
  • Scholarship Opportunities
  • Opportunity to earn University course credits
  • Hands on career experience in a restaurant business

PREREQUISITES
Education: High school diploma or equivalent
Experience: A minimum of 1 year of experience in a restaurant environment.


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
Communication and organizational skills

Physical: Ability to work any area of the restaurant as needed and to operate computerized Point of Sale system/cash register. This position requires bending, standing and walking the entire workday. Must have the ability to lift 10 pounds frequently and up to 30 pounds occasionally.
